Scientists Warn of Earth's Alarming 31.5-Inch Shift
A new study published in Geophysical Research Letters reports that Earth's rotational axis has shifted by 31.5 inches in less than two decades, mainly due to human activities such as groundwater pumping. This discovery, led by researchers including Ki-Weon Seo from Seoul National University, challenges existing beliefs about Earth's rotation and its potential effects on climate change. The study highlights that the significant redistribution of groundwater has altered Earth's mass distribution, which could lead to rising sea levels and climate instability.

The implications of this research extend beyond a mere scientific novelty. The shift of Earth's axis by such a considerable amount, attributed to groundwater extraction, underscores a growing concern. As more freshwater is diverted for agricultural and domestic use, this issue not only reconfigures the planet's rotation but also exacerbates an already critical situation concerning sea-level rise. Awareness around this link between groundwater depletion and climate change is crucial for developing effective climate action policies.
